All Boat Ramps in Camden County
- Cabbage Swamppublic
| # | Name | City | Waterbody | Rating |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Little Satilla Boat Ramp | Spring Bluff | Little Satilla River | 4.3/5 |
| 2 | Waterfront Park And Boat Ramp | Woodbine | Satilla River | 4.7/5 |
| 3 | Meeting Street Boat Ramp | St. Marys | North River | 4.7/5 |
| 4 | Harrietts Bluff Boat Ramp | Harrietts Bluff | Pine Barren Swamp | 4.7/5 |
| 5 | White Oak Creek Boat Ramp | White Oak | White Oak Creek | 4.0/5 |
| 6 | St Marys - St Marys St W Boat Ramp | St. Marys | Saint Marys River | 4.8/5 |
| 7 | Temple Landing Boat Ramp | — | Cabbage Swamp | 4.1/5 |

Quick Reference: Launching in Camden County
Check Conditions
Monitor weather forecasts and water conditions before each trip. Local tackle shops often post current reports that help anglers plan productive outings.
Fees & Permits
Launch fees vary by facility and season. Some Camden County ramps are free while others require daily or annual passes. Check posted signs at each location.
Safety Requirements
Georgia requires valid registration, personal flotation devices, and appropriate safety equipment. Verify your vessel meets all requirements before launching.
